## Changelog — v4.2.0

This release changes several defaults in the Murmurhall audio-guide app. Offline bundle prefetching is now enabled by default on gallery Wi-Fi, the playback resume window was extended from 30 to 120 seconds, and auto-advance between exhibit stops is off unless a curator tour is active. Please read these carefully, since older deployments pinned the previous values explicitly. The new defaults shipped with this version are listed here.

service settings:
WENATH_PIN=5007
WENATH_METRICS_HOST=metrics.wenath.tolvaqlabs.corp
WENATH_LOG_LEVEL=debug
WENATH_TENANT=rusox

Action Item 7: Harden the Bouncewright email bounce processor against malformed DSN payloads. During the incident, a single non-RFC-compliant bounce report stalled the parsing worker, and retries amplified the backlog until suppression-list updates lagged by six hours. Future maintainers should add schema validation at ingest, a dead-letter path for unparseable messages, and an alert on queue age rather than queue depth. Owner: Telka, platform team. The full remediation design and rollout checklist are documented on the internal page below.

runbook for badug-kadup: https://confluence.zemvarlabs.internal/projects/browse/display/projects/bd1b

Q2 Planning Note — Marvale Line Pricing

Finance team: we are holding list prices on the Marvale line through Q2, with a 4% increase planned for the entry tier in Q3. Bundle discounts will be capped at 12%. Please update forecast models accordingly and flag any contracts with price-lock clauses. The rationale ties to the plan noted below.

internal memo for kawip-hadug: Headcount on the Wenwyn team goes from 7 to 140 by the end of January. Gross margin on Wenwyn came in at 20 percent against a plan of 15 percent.

## Onboarding: Farebranch Rules Engine

Plugin authors integrate with Farebranch by registering fee rules against the evaluation API. Rules are sandboxed; they cannot perform network calls directly. All rate-table lookups go through the host, which validates your plugin manifest at load time. Your local env file must include the signing credential the host uses to verify manifests, set on the next line.

secret setting of bajef-fajof: COURIER_KEY3=76c